Ice Breaker Preview (10/11-12)
Following a 7-4 win at Miami, our Falcons (1-0-0) head north on I-75 to host the Ice Breaker tournament as the #17 team in the nation. BG plays RIT in the late game on Friday night at 8:00pm, following the matchup between #12 Ohio State and #14 Western Michigan. This tournament is structured similar to the GLI that we won a few year ago, so with a win we will get the winner and with a loss we will get the loser. Regardless, I hope our boys are fired up for this one - I want that trophy.
RIT’s last game out was a win on the road at Colgate, 3-1. WMU’s last game out was an exhibition win over Northern Alberta Institute of Technology, 6-1. OSU’s last game out was an exhibition win over Western, 5-2.

It’s early in the season, so I will use career stats to give a more accurate picture of each probable net-minder’s ability:
BGSU
Jr. Eric Dop... GAA - 2.14, SV% - .915, 14–7-3
RIT
Jr. Logan Drackett... GAA - 2.86, SV% - .899, 22–26-6
OSU
Jr. Tommy Nappier... GAA - 1.76, SV% - .938, 16-4-3
WMU
Sr. Ben Blacker… GAA - 2.89, SV% - .902, 29-23-4
